Casimir Effect for a Dielectric Wedge
Abstract
The Casimir effect is considered for a wedge with opening angle $α$, with perfectly conducting walls, when the interior region is filled with an isotropic and nondispersive medium with permittivity $ε$ and permeability $μ$. The electromagnetic energy-momentum tensor in the bulk is calculated, together with the surface stress on the walls. A discussion is given on the possibilities for measuring the influence of the medium, via the Casimir-Polder force.
